Paricalcitol Side Effects

The most commonly reported side effects of paricalcitol include death, cardiac disorder, and myocardial infarction, based on 14,218 FDA adverse event reports from 2004 to 2025.

Co-occurrence in adverse event reports does not establish a drug interaction. Patients often take multiple medications, and these lists reflect prescribing patterns rather than causal relationships. Consult a healthcare provider about potential drug interactions.

Who reports paricalcitol side effects

43.0% of paricalcitol adverse event reports involve female patients and 53.8% involve male patients. The largest age group is adult at 57%. These figures reflect who reports side effects, not underlying risk.
